Transaction 20eabf80c277123371a718e993f676abc5996823863e6df4a7064c024ef5fb6c

1 Input
2 Outputs
  • 20eabf80c277123371a718e993f676abc5996823863e6df4a7064c024ef5fb6c:0
  • value  59532
    address  16uwXG15QzT2MQj1pb7crGj8yzBTxiqTQS
  • 20eabf80c277123371a718e993f676abc5996823863e6df4a7064c024ef5fb6c:1
  • value  16654286
    address  3JVAL4gmy2GqYkUDmhscfvJbWmEAPjxryX